Transaction 67acdf823af700a3b6403200e789247609d6b60fc6d28dc85df15a9111fc500d
1 Input
1 Output
-
67acdf823af700a3b6403200e789247609d6b60fc6d28dc85df15a9111fc500d:0
- value
- 344795
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9c7cfa86d654a4feac848f1a1da9a03bf6547d4 OP_EQUAL
- address
- 3MYXvJ1GVPk6CrKwxxYCR5xMs341RVEQKu